Planning a wedding is not a easy task, as every detail must be carefully chosen. The music played at the wedding has to be well organized and it's very important that you both agree on the type of wedding music you want played at your wedding.

The wedding is traditionally devided into 3 parts where songs can be integrated; these are the bridal entrance,  the actual ceremony and the party, each one of them having a particular role in presenting the couple Wedding music during the ceremony is  secondary to the ceremony itself, when the vows are exchanged; the music  played at the reception is more important.  The first dance song is the one that stands out, usually being used in the dance of the bride and groom, which will use a special song that has some memories associated with their love story. This first dance at the wedding reception is a special moment that takes months of decision upon the song on which is played. Each couple has a song they call theirs, usually being the song they first danced on, so this song may be also the one suited for their first dance as husband and wife.



With so many songs available these days it is a hard task to find  the right ones that you can use for your ceremony and reception. You can choose classic love songs as Aerosmith-- I Don't Want to Miss a Thing, Elton John-- Can You Feel the Love Tonight?, Stevie Wonder-- I Just Called to Say I Love You , etc or  popular love songs as Mariah Carey-- We Belong Together, Aaliyah-- One in a Million.. Either you play classic songs, custom songs or unconventional songs, the most important thing is that this songs represent you and the couple, as they celebrate the communion of your love. Using music as a way to celebrate your love will have a significant meaning to you and your partner in the future, as you will remember important moments accompanied by particular tunes. The choice of each song will bring a personal touch to your ceremony, as the music will set up the tone and rithm of your reception. If you know you have musical talent, a great surprise is to sing a personalized song, with custom lyrics that will melt everyone’s heart. But what if you want something customized but you don’t want to sing it? There’s no problem!! There are artists and companies that will write lyrics according to your information and  record the music with the support of a specialized vocalist, helping you make a memorable playlist.

You may choose for your reception a  live band, that will make the crowd dance for hours, entertaining the guest with a upbeat playlist and integrating different songs in a perfect atmosphere. Get an experienced band,  that has been to other weddings too, because they know exactly what are the perfect tunes for this occasion.
